The future of cinema is truly global as we are seeing more and more. More Indian films, Indian actors are making waves on the world stage than ever before. Indian films are being celebrated at the Oscars. At the Golden Globes. ‘Citadel’ the web-series starring Priyanka Chopra has become Prime Video’s most-watched ever. On the other hand, the best of the world’s cinema is now available to audiences from Srinagar to Sriperumbudur in their own mother tongue. The language of film is now being seen, heard and felt by the world’s most linguistically diverse nation.

MIT WPU Admissions 2024 Open - Apply Now 

It is no surprise that we as a country have a lot to contribute to this global wave of cinema. Because we have a mind-boggling variety and magnitude of films—nearly 2000 a year—in over 20 languages, some of which are spoken by only a few thousand people like Chakma, Nagamese, Mizo and Sherdukpen. We also have a story-telling tradition that dates back to antiquity. Much like our films it was tradition that understood the importance of dance or nritya, emotion or bhav, expression or abhinaya and most-importantly the rasas—the building blocks of the craft of stage and screen acting.

On the financial side, the Indian film industry is also worth 15000 crore rupees and is growing. It is a sector that has been consistently giving jobs to people since more than 100 years. In its influence Indian cinema is second only to the American as our films are seen across the world: from China to the Middle East to the West Indies and wherever else the South Asian diaspora is found.

It is with a mind to celebrate Indian cinema that we at MIT World Peace University decided to launch the Dadasaheb Phalke International Film School in April this year at the hands of veteran actor Nana Patekar who appreciated our endeavour towards this end of bringing film education to people who need it most.

The Dadasaheb Phalke International Film School is the fruit of the vision of Shri Rahul Karad, Executive President of MIT-WPU, who has a firm belief that higher education in films would bring us at par with the rest of the world. His dream of creating in Pune a school that aims higher, dreams bigger and seeks out to create filmmakers of the future with strong roots in our own culture will be realised through our School. We are in this grand endeavour one with the philosophy of Shri Abhijit Panse, a filmmaker with a very clear and distinguished voice in the industry, who is the Creative Director of DPIFS. Of course all this would not have been possible without the original dream of our beloved founder Prof Vishwanath D. Karad who created a legacy of excellence in higher education with the MIT Group of institutions.

Dadasaheb Phalke International Film School is going to be a sangam or confluence of these legacies but with an eye on the future, where technology and the ability to tell stories across genres and styles is going to be key. We aim to create filmmakers, actors, cinematographers and sound designers who know their craft as well as have the capacity to think out of the box.

Currently, we are offering a BA Filmmaking programme that is one of the first in the country based on the new National Education Policy. In keeping with the NEP ours is a 4-year honours degree programme with multi exit options. Our faculty is exceptional with years of film industry experience. And to guide us in our journey into the future we have leading lights of the industry such as former Director, National School of Drama Waman Kendre, Gangs of Wasseypur music director Sneha Khanwalkar, actor and producer Atul Agnihotri to name just a few.
